Fluidsim 5.0 Software Via DDEįinally, FluidSIM provides a good range of possibilities for communication with other software via DDE and OPC and thanks to the support of Festo EasyPorts a link up to real hardware is also possible. The trial verson can be used for 30 days and the sessions are limited to 30 minutes.It also offérs a new simuIation core need nót fear a cómparison with more éxpensive special program, só professionals get á good advantage.ĭespite complex physicaI models and précise mathematical procedures simuIation is amazingly fást.We're talking about a trial version, therefore, if you want to make use of its full features, you'll have to purchase a license.
